Subject: CachePane key rotation following stale-cache postmortem

Hello plugin authors,

Following the stale-cache incident documented in last week's postmortem, we are rotating all credentials for the CachePane invalidation service. The old key is revoked effective immediately, since it was logged in plaintext during the incident window. Please update your plugin manifests before your next release; requests with the revoked key will return 403. The replacement key is included below.

app token of kafop-hahaf = kto11_iRLdsMBafGn

Subject: Key rotation + sort fix heads-up

Hey — quick one before Thursday's cut. The Fernwheel report builder finally uses a stable sort, so grouped rows won't shuffle between runs anymore. Regression suite is green. Side effect: the rotation invalidated the old Cobblemist key that the builder uses for export jobs, so update the release config before tagging. New key for the Cobblemist export service is below.

app token of badug-tahaf = qvz11-nP5FBNr8qnh

Step 7: Mitigate flaky DNS resolution on Larkspur nodes

If deploys to the Larkspur cluster intermittently fail with resolution timeouts, the internal resolver pool is likely cycling. Pin the Quillbridge service to the static resolver endpoint before retrying the rollout. Update the resolver entry in /etc/quillbridge/env, restart the agent, and confirm lookups succeed twice in a row. Then add the resolver auth secret on the next line of that file, as follows.

sealed setting: ARCHIVE_KEY3=a6a

Subject: Handover — Prattle config hot-reload review

Hi Soren,

Handing over release context for your security review. Prattle 4.2 introduces hot-reloading of service configuration: the watcher picks up changes to the mounted config volume and applies them without a restart. Reloaded configs are signature-checked before application, so tampered files are ignored and logged. Please review the verification path and the reload audit trail. The signing key used for config verification is below.

rollout seal: bky9_PeXH1fTLY